NO. 70 WILL SMITH, RDE (2000-2003)
Born: 1981 (Queens, NY)
High School: Utica Proctor
OHIO STATE CAREER
- The Buckeyes were 40-11 with Smith on the team.
- Played on the 2002 national championship team.
- 2002 Big Ten Title.
- Defeated 13 ranked teams.
- Started three years at defensive end.
HONORS
- 2003 All-American.
- 2003 Big Ten Defensive Player of the Year.
- 2003 Big Ten Defensive Lineman of the Year.
- 2003 All-Big Ten.
- 2002 Second Team All-Big Ten.
- Ohio State All-Decade Team 2000-09.
NFL Draft
Round 1 to the New Orleans with the 18th pick of the 2004 draft.
MISCELLANEOUS
- Played for the Saints and won Super Bowl XLIV.
- 2006 Pro Bowl.
- He wants to be an FBI agent.

WILL SMITH'S OHIO STATE CAREER PER TheWillSmith.com:
Three-year starter at RDE for Ohio State, finishing with career totals of 167 tackles (111 solo), 21 sacks, five forced fumbles, two fumble recoveries, and an interception…Selected to OSU’s All-Decade Team…Opened 37 of 51 career games…Sack total ranked fifth in OSU history upon his departure…First-team All-American, All-Big 10 selection and conference’s Defensive Player of the Year and Defensive Lineman of the Year as senior, posting 49 tackles (30 solo), 10½ sacks and 20 stops for a loss…Finalist for Hendricks Award, given to nation’s top end…All-Big 10 second-team as junior, appearing in every game despite suffering a midseason knee sprain, as he was one of the team leaders on a National Championship team…Recorded 5.5 sacks, a forced fumble, an interception and a fumble recovery…Named Outstanding First-Year Defensive Player as freshman with three sacks.
